That was today (Monday), I posted about 15 mins after I boated him, I was pretty stoked and it beats my PB by 1cm although today's fish was pretty young and light weight for the length, I didn't weigh it but I reckon only between 4 and 5kg. Still, my neighbour cooked up half of it tonight on the BBQ and it was really good tasting and still firm and juicy. I don't normally rate snapper on the plate but I usually freeze it first and that ruins it I think.

In summary, there were about 20 boats out from corinella today, half went north and fished around the same place as me. Spoke to a few other on the ramp and 2 out of 4 had boated a snapper. So I guess it's early but they are about already. Also got 2 just size gummies and kept one. Whole pilchard and squid rings were bait of choice and bite time for snapper was about 30 mins out of 7 hours on the water, 99% of it was slack or ebbing. 7-10 meters of water, 14 degrees.

Chris seafarer: 2 seasons ago i was fishing from warneet and found we got on to them early in about 10m of water, just south of joes is in the top end. Have been launching from corinella and newhaven for a while now though.
